Assessment and Inspection
Our technicians start with a full assessment. They look at the size of the leak and the type of tank. They check for water damage in nearby areas. This helps us understand the scope of the work. We use moisture meters to find hidden water. This step is critical to making sure we address all issues.
Water Removal
We use powerful extraction tools to remove standing water. This is the fastest way to prevent further damage. We work quickly but carefully. Every drop of water is important. We make sure all wet materials are handled properly. This step is the foundation of the entire process.
Dehumidification and Drying
After water is removed, we start drying the area. We use industrial fans and dehumidifiers. This helps prevent mold and other problems. We monitor the drying process closely. We make sure everything is dry before moving on. This step can take 3-5 days depending on the situation.
Sanitization and Cleaning
We clean all affected surfaces to prevent bacteria and mold. This is a crucial step for your health. We use safe and effective cleaning solutions. We make sure everything is restored to its original condition. This step helps your home feel fresh and safe again.
Final Inspection and Reporting
We do a final inspection to make sure everything is done right. We provide a detailed report of the work. This is important for insurance claims. We make sure you understand what was done. We’re here to answer any questions you might have. This step is your final check for peace of mind.

Aquarium Leak Water Removal Cost In Mechanicsville, VA
Costs vary depending on the size of the leak and the damage. You can expect to pay between $500 and $2,500 for typical repairs. This includes water removal and drying. The more damage there is, the higher the cost. Every situation is different, so it’s best to get an estimate.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ction and Removal | $500 – $1,200 | Size of the leak and amount of water.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$600 – $1,800 | Duration of the drying process and equipment used. |
| Sanitization and Mold Removal | $300 – $800 | Extent of mold and type of cleaning needed. |
| Damage Repair and Restoration | $400 – $1,500 | Level of damage and materials required. |
| Insurance Help and Paperwork | $100 – $300 | Complexity of the insurance claim and documentation needed. |
| 24/7 Emergency Response | $200 – $600 | Urgency of the situation and availability of our team. |
